Yesterday evening we resumed tuning the ITF working point, since the fringe level in CARM NULL 1f was too high to proceed in LN3 (0.04 mW).
In particular, the DAS actuation setpoints were re-optimized. I initially adjusted the WI DAS, since the WI CO2 laser experienced some issues, but this only worsened the fringe.
I then moved on to the NI, and the actuator that had the largest effect in reducing the fringe was the NI inner ring, lowering it to about 0.03 mW (see attached figure).
The nominal powers previously used, together with the updated values applied yesterday evening, are summarized in the table below (the latter are highlighted in bold).
